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/179.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android 我的手机应用程序没有出现在google play商店中_Android_Android Manifest_Google Play - Fatal编程技术网

Android 我的手机应用程序没有出现在google play商店中

Android 我的手机应用程序没有出现在google play商店中,android,android-manifest,google-play,Android,Android Manifest,Google Play,我有一个带有以下清单的应用程序,我在手机上看不到。几乎所有人都能看到,但手机之间的共同点是,它们没有工作sim卡或正在国外漫游。我可以在舱单上做些什么更改,使其不需要运营商或sim卡吗?我使用的是三星Galaxy S3,我的朋友使用的版本与Galaxy S3完全相同,他可以看到该应用程序(他有一张工作sim卡) 那么,添加这些行会抵消这一点吗 <uses-feature android:name="android.hardware.location" android:required="f

我有一个带有以下清单的应用程序,我在手机上看不到。几乎所有人都能看到,但手机之间的共同点是,它们没有工作sim卡或正在国外漫游。我可以在舱单上做些什么更改,使其不需要运营商或sim卡吗?我使用的是三星Galaxy S3,我的朋友使用的版本与Galaxy S3完全相同,他可以看到该应用程序(他有一张工作sim卡)

那么,添加这些行会抵消这一点吗

<uses-feature android:name="android.hardware.location" android:required="false" />
<uses-feature android:name="android.hardware.location.network" android:required="false" />
<uses-feature android:name="android.hardware.location.gps" android:required="false" />

当你的应用程序不支持你的手机时,就会发生这种情况。要确认,请检查您的google play商店控制台

APK

排除的设备0管理排除的设备

在你的情况下,你会得到一些被排除的设备,浏览它们,你应该在那里找到你的手机

如果您在清单中执行以下操作,您应该能够在排除的设备上获得
0

<uses-sdk
    android:minSdkVersion="8"
    android:targetSdkVersion="16" />

<supports-screens
    android:anyDensity="true"
    android:largeScreens="true"
    android:normalScreens="true"
    android:smallScreens="true" />

编辑:刚刚看到你的更新

同时,将这些添加到您的清单中,这样您就不会使location.gps变得必不可少

<uses-feature
    android:name="android.hardware.location.gps"
    android:required="false" />

尝试在清单中添加以下行

<uses-feature android:glEsVersion="0x00020000"
         android:required="true"/> 


为了获取更多信息,我可以去谷歌Play Store网站下载该应用程序,但在Play Store应用程序上看不到它。尝试将targetsdkversion更改为17Ah已经尝试过了,但没有效果。不过刚刚更新了一些新信息。你在你的项目中使用gps和谷歌服务吗?是的,但我会处理gps不可用的情况。请解释一下为什么这会有帮助?请看这个仅供参考:我的清单中没有,我没有排除的设备。好的,谢谢,我拥有的任何使用权限是否暗示了android.hardware.telephony使用功能?是什么让你觉得我应该加上它?我想我可能真的需要它,我只是想知道是什么让你加上它?
<uses-sdk
    android:minSdkVersion="8"
    android:targetSdkVersion="16" />

<supports-screens
    android:anyDensity="true"
    android:largeScreens="true"
    android:normalScreens="true"
    android:smallScreens="true" />
<uses-feature
    android:name="android.hardware.location.gps"
    android:required="false" />
<uses-feature android:glEsVersion="0x00020000"
         android:required="true"/>